volume of cylinder = πr²h
πr²h = 127.23 cubic inches
3.14 * 3 * 3 * h = 127.23
h = 127.23 / 3*3*3.14
=127.23 * 100 /3*3*3.14*100
=12723/ 3*3*314
= 4241 / 3*314
=4241/ 942
=4.502 inches
h = 4.5 inches

Find the area of two sides (Length*Height)*2 sides.
Find the area of adjacent sides (Width*Height)*2 sides.
Find the area of ends (Length*Width)*2 ends.
Add the three areas together to find the surface area.
